TerraBella Shelby Costs & Pricing
At TerraBella Shelby, the monthly costs for various room types are competitively aligned with those of Cleveland County, reflecting a consistent pricing structure across both entities. For instance, the semi-private room is priced at $2,915, which mirrors the county's rate and stands in contrast to the higher state average of $3,584. The one-bedroom option is also set at $3,540, again matching the county while remaining below North Carolina's state average of $4,055. Residents seeking more space have access to two-bedroom accommodations for $4,365 - a price that remains consistent with local rates and is slightly higher than the state's average of $4,245. Interestingly, studio apartments at TerraBella Shelby are listed at $6,045, which significantly surpasses both the county and statewide averages - $6,045 at TerraBella compared to a more modest state average of $4,020. Overall, while many options present favorable pricing against broader market comparisons in North Carolina, TerraBella Shelby's studio rooms illustrate a unique positioning that may warrant further consideration by prospective residents.

Overall Review of TerraBella Shelby
common24 reviews mention this
Staff care and responsiveness
Residents and families frequently describe the staff as genuinely caring and responsive.
Across many reviews, families say staff make residents feel welcome and supported, including during move-in transitions. Multiple reviewers mention staff checking in about meals, addressing questions, and making sure day-to-day needs are met. A few reviews also raise communication or professionalism issues, but even those describe staff that were, at least at times, helpful.
common10 reviews mention this
Dining feels thoughtful and varied
Dining is a frequent bright spot, with residents saying they never go hungry.
Several reviews highlight the dining room experience and describe residents enjoying meals most of the time. Families mention that staff ask how meals went and offer options without judgment, and one reviewer notes a transition that still included variety. The community offers restaurant-style dining and supports meals and special diets, including diabetes-related dietary support.
differentiator9 reviews mention this
Memory care programming stands out
Memory care reviews focus on structured activities and a design meant to keep residents engaged and safe.
Residents in memory care are mentioned repeatedly, with reviewers describing the unit as well designed and supported during transitions. Multiple reviews mention activities tailored to memory care, along with a safe outdoor space that memory care residents can access. The community also provides specialized memory care programming and includes dementia-waiver related care services alongside medication management and meal preparation.
common8 reviews mention this
Cleanliness is mostly positive
Many reviewers say the facility is kept clean and well maintained.
Several families describe the community as neat, clean, and well maintained, including rooms and shared areas. A couple of reviews, however, point to specific issues like unpleasant odors or missing laundry items, which they say affected the overall experience. Overall, cleanliness and upkeep come up often in positive reviews, even when other concerns are raised.
caveat5 reviews mention this
Cost concerns come up repeatedly
Some families say pricing has become a limiting factor or feels too high.
A handful of reviews mention that the price increased or that it felt almost unaffordable, and one reviewer says the community was “not in my price range.” Another review includes cost sensitivity alongside concerns about value for what families provide separately. In pricing ranges, the community can price above county benchmarks for some unit types while remaining below state benchmarks, which helps explain why different families land differently on value.

Dementia, particularly Lewy body dementia, often involves hallucinations that can significantly distress both patients and caregivers due to disruptions in sensory processing and neurotransmitter imbalances. Effective management includes compassionate communication, environmental adjustments, and a multidisciplinary approach to care while addressing the emotional needs of caregivers.
Alzheimer’s disease is a progressive neurological disorder that significantly impacts memory and cognitive functions, accounting for 60-80% of dementia cases, with early diagnosis being crucial yet challenging. It involves brain changes like beta-amyloid plaques and tau tangles, influenced by genetic and lifestyle factors, and while there is no cure, symptom management and support for caregivers are essential.
Dementia, influenced by aging and certain medications, may be exacerbated by drug classes such as anticholinergics, benzodiazepines, and antipsychotics, which are associated with cognitive impairment. Regular medication reviews by healthcare professionals are crucial for older adults to manage risks and optimize cognitive health.
